What is Double Glazing?
Double glazing, likewise referred to as double-pane or insulated glass, includes 2 glass panes separated by a layer of air or gas. This air or gas acts as an insulating barrier, lowering heat transfer between the within and outside of a home. The primary benefits of double glazing include improved insulation, sound reduction, and increased security.

Types of Double Glazing
UPVC (Unplasticized Polyvinyl Chloride)
- Durability: UPVC windows are extremely long lasting and require minimal upkeep.
- Economical: They are usually less costly than other materials.
- Energy Efficiency: UPVC frames are outstanding insulators, contributing to total energy efficiency.
Aluminum
- Strength: Aluminum frames are really strong and lightweight.
- Thermal Break: Modern aluminum windows typically include a thermal break, which reduces heat transfer.
- Upkeep: They are resistant to rust and need very little maintenance.
Wood
- Natural Beauty: Wooden frames provide a timeless, natural appearance that can enhance the aesthetic of duration residential or commercial properties.
- Insulation: Wood is a natural insulator, providing good thermal efficiency.
- Maintenance: Wooden frames require regular painting or staining to preserve their appearance and avoid rot.
Composite
- Combination of Materials: Composite windows integrate the very best features of different products, such as the strength of aluminum and the insulation of wood.
- Low Maintenance: They provide the durability of aluminum with the aesthetic of wood, requiring less maintenance.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: Is double glazing more expensive than single glazing?
- A: Yes, double glazing is normally more expensive than single glazing due to the additional products and making processes involved. Nevertheless, the energy savings and increased convenience frequently offset the greater initial expense gradually.
Q: Can double glazing be installed in older residential or commercial properties?
- A: Yes, double glazing can be installed in older homes, consisting of those in conservation locations. However, it might be necessary to choose windows that match the home's original design to comply with local policies.
Q: Does double glazing eliminate condensation?
- A: While double glazing can considerably minimize condensation, it does not eliminate it completely. Appropriate ventilation and humidity control are still important to avoid condensation.
Q: How long does double glazing last?
- A: With appropriate maintenance, double glazing can last for 20-30 years. The life expectancy can differ depending upon the materials utilized and the quality of setup.

Certifications and Accreditations
- FENSA: Ensure the installer is FENSA (Fenestration Self-Assessment Scheme) certified, which guarantees that the work fulfills regulative standards.
- BFRC: Look for BFRC (British Fenestration Rating Council) rankings, which show the energy performance of the windows.
